Abstract
In this paper firstly we explain why we can use the condition ¿H/¿u =0 when applying the Qualitative Maximum Principle to solve the controllability problems for linear system. Then we give two applications of this principle. One of which is to prove a controllability criterion for the time varying linear system. The other is to give a theorem about the determination of the controllable region of linear time invariant system where it is not completely controllable. Together with other applications it can be seen that the Qualitative Maximum Principle may serve as the theoritical foundation for the controllability problems.
